Prashanth S. Venkataram is a scholar working on Civil and Structural Engineering, Atomic and Molecular Physics, and Optics and Statistical and Nonlinear Physics. According to data from OpenAlex, Prashanth S. Venkataram has authored 16 papers receiving a total of 356 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Civil and Structural Engineering, 10 papers in Atomic and Molecular Physics, and Optics and 5 papers in Statistical and Nonlinear Physics. Recurrent topics in Prashanth S. Venkataram's work include Thermal Radiation and Cooling Technologies (12 papers), Quantum Electrodynamics and Casimir Effect (8 papers) and Advanced Thermodynamics and Statistical Mechanics (5 papers). Prashanth S. Venkataram is often cited by papers focused on Thermal Radiation and Cooling Technologies (12 papers), Quantum Electrodynamics and Casimir Effect (8 papers) and Advanced Thermodynamics and Statistical Mechanics (5 papers). Prashanth S. Venkataram collaborates with scholars based in United States, Spain and Germany. Prashanth S. Venkataram's co-authors include Alejandro W. Rodríguez, Riccardo Messina, Juan Carlos Cuevas, Philippe Ben‐Abdallah, Svend‐Age Biehs, Sean Molesky, Weiliang Jin, Jan Hermann, Alexandre Tkatchenko and Jesus M. Barajas and has published in prestigious journals such as Physical Review Letters, Reviews of Modern Physics and Physical review. B..
